So I work in software engineering which means I spend pretty much all day at work coding or dealing with data. The thing is I learned to touch-type in French so I use a CMS keyboard instead of the US keyboard but most programming languages use characters that aren’t on the CMS keyboard like []{}<> so I keep having to switch to US keyboard for one character and then switch back and I’ve realised that ctrl+shift is just second nature to me when I have to type. I love brains sometimes. Even when they suck they’re so interesting.
Now, I often forget to switch back and end up with < instead of ‘ all the time lmao but we don’t talk about that.

Top B.Tech Courses in Maharashtra – CSE, AI, IT, and ECE Compared
B.Tech courses continue to attract students across India, and Maharashtra remains one of the most preferred states for higher technical education. From metro cities to emerging academic hubs like Solapur, students get access to diverse courses and skilled faculty. Among all available options, four major branches stand out: Computer Science and Engineering (CSE), Artificial Intelligence (AI), Information Technology (IT), and Electronics and Communication Engineering (ECE).
Each of these streams offers a different learning path. B.Tech in Computer Science and Engineering focuses on coding, algorithms, and system design. Students learn Python, Java, data structures, software engineering, and database systems. These skills are relevant for software companies, startups, and IT consulting.
B.Tech in Artificial Intelligence covers deep learning, neural networks, data processing, and computer vision. Students work on real-world problems using AI models. They also learn about ethical AI practices and automation systems. Companies hiring AI talent are in healthcare, retail, fintech, and manufacturing.
B.Tech in IT trains students in systems administration, networking, cloud computing, and application services. Graduates often work in system support, IT infrastructure, and data management. IT blends technical and management skills for enterprise use.
B.Tech ECE is for students who enjoy working with circuits, embedded systems, mobile communication, robotics, and signal processing. This stream is useful for telecom companies, consumer electronics, and control systems in industries.
Key Differences Between These B.Tech Programs:
CSE is programming-intensive. IT includes applications and system-level operations.
AI goes deeper into data modeling and pattern recognition.
ECE focuses more on hardware, communication, and embedded tech.
AI and CSE overlap, but AI involves more research-based learning.
How to Choose the Right B.Tech Specialization:
Ask yourself what excites you: coding, logic, data, devices, or systems.
Look for colleges with labs, project-based learning, and internship support.
Talk to seniors or alumni to understand real-life learning and placements.
Explore industry demand and long-term growth in each field.

Voice Service
Voice services, such as Voice over Internet Protocol (VoIP) or Voice as a Service (VaaS), are telecommunications technologies that convert Voice into a digital signal and route conversations through digital channels. Businesses use these technologies to place and receive reliable, high-quality calls through their internet connection instead of traditional telephones. We at Sinch provide the best voice service all over India.
Voice Messaging Service
A Voice Messaging Service or System, also known as Voice Broadcasting, is the process by which an individual or organization sends a pre-recorded message to a list of contacts without manually dialing each number. Automated Voice Message service makes communicating with customers and employees efficient and effective. With mobile marketing quickly becoming the fastest-growing advertising industry sector, the ability to send a voice broadcast via professional voice messaging software is now a crucial element of any marketing or communication initiative.

Top Technical Skills for Electronics Engineer Resume in 2024
Electronics and Communication Engineering (ECE) offers a wide array of career opportunities due to its interdisciplinary nature, combining principles from electronics, telecommunications, and computer science. Here are the top 15 career options for graduates in this field:
1. Telecom Engineer
Telecom engineers design and manage communication systems, including optical fibers, microwave transmission, and IP networks. They analyze existing technologies and develop new solutions to enhance communication reliability and efficiency.
2. R&D Software Engineer
These engineers focus on creating and testing new software products. They play a crucial role in research and development, working on automation and mechanical controls to improve software systems across various industries.
3. Software Analyst
Software analysts design, develop, and test software applications, ensuring they meet user needs. They act as a bridge between developers and users, managing software updates and enhancing user experience.
4. Electronic Design Engineer
Electronic design engineers create electronic circuits and devices tailored to specific requirements. They work on projects ranging from consumer electronics to complex communication systems.
5. Embedded Systems Engineer
Embedded systems engineers develop software for embedded systems found in various devices like appliances, medical equipment, and automotive systems. This role requires proficiency in both hardware and software development.
6. Network Engineer
Network engineers design, implement, and manage computer networks within organizations. They ensure network security and optimize performance for efficient data transfer.
7. Service Engineer
Service engineers maintain and repair electronic equipment used in various industries. Their work ensures that systems operate smoothly, minimizing downtime for businesses.
8. Technical Sales Engineer
In this role, engineers leverage their technical knowledge to sell complex electronic products or services. They often work closely with clients to understand their needs and provide tailored solutions.
9. Quality Assurance Engineer
Quality assurance engineers focus on testing products to ensure they meet required standards before they are released to the market. This role involves developing testing protocols and analyzing results to improve product quality.
10. Systems Engineer
Systems engineers oversee the integration of various subsystems into a complete system, ensuring all components work together effectively. This role is critical in projects involving complex electronic systems.
11. Electronics Technician
Electronics technicians assist in the design, development, and testing of electronic equipment. They often work under the supervision of engineers to troubleshoot issues and perform repairs.
12. Data Analyst
Data analysts in the ECE field focus on interpreting data related to electronic systems or communications networks. They use statistical tools to provide insights that can improve system performance or user experience.
13. Technical Director
Technical directors oversee engineering projects from conception through execution, ensuring technical feasibility while managing teams of engineers. They play a pivotal role in strategic planning within organizations.
14. Chief Technical Officer (CTO)
As a senior executive, the CTO is responsible for overseeing the technological direction of a company. This role involves strategic decision-making regarding technology investments and innovations.
15. Research Scientist
Research scientists in ECE focus on advancing knowledge in areas like telecommunications or signal processing through experimental research or theoretical analysis. This role often requires advanced degrees (MTech or PhD) for positions in academia or specialized industries.

A Comprehensive Guide to the Top Industries Attracting FDI in India
India has emerged as one of the most attractive destinations for Foreign Direct Investment (FDI) in recent years, thanks to its robust economic growth, favorable demographics, and ongoing policy reforms. FDI plays a crucial role in stimulating economic development by bringing in capital, technology, and expertise. In this comprehensive guide, we will delve into the top industries that are attracting FDI in India.
1. Information Technology (IT) and Software Services:
India's IT industry has been a pioneer in attracting FDI, fueling the country's economic growth and creating millions of jobs. With a large pool of skilled IT professionals, cost-effective services, and a conducive business environment, India continues to be a global hub for software development, IT outsourcing, and business process outsourcing (BPO).
India's Information Technology (IT) and software services industry have been pivotal in attracting Foreign Direct Investment (FDI) due to several key factors:
1. Skilled Workforce:
India boasts a vast pool of highly skilled IT professionals, including software engineers, developers, and project managers. The country's education system emphasizes STEM (Science, Technology, Engineering, and Mathematics) fields, producing a large number of graduates with expertise in computer science and information technology. This skilled workforce is instrumental in delivering high-quality software development, IT outsourcing, and business process outsourcing (BPO) services to clients worldwide.
2. Cost-Effectiveness:
The cost of labor in India is significantly lower compared to developed countries, making it an attractive destination for outsourcing IT projects and services. Foreign companies can leverage India's cost-effective labor market to reduce their operational expenses while maintaining high standards of quality and efficiency. This cost advantage has been a major driver for multinational corporations to set up offshore development centers and service delivery hubs in India.
3. Conducive Business Environment:
India offers a conducive business environment for IT companies, characterized by liberalized policies, supportive government initiatives, and a well-established legal framework. The government has implemented various reforms to promote ease of doing business, simplify regulatory procedures, and encourage foreign investment in the IT sector. Additionally, initiatives such as Digital India and Make in India have further propelled the growth of the IT industry by fostering innovation, entrepreneurship, and technology adoption.
4. Global Reputation:
Over the years, India has built a strong reputation as a leading destination for IT and software services globally. Indian IT companies have demonstrated expertise in delivering cutting-edge solutions, leveraging emerging technologies, and meeting the diverse needs of clients across industries. This reputation has attracted multinational corporations to partner with Indian firms, outsource IT projects, and establish long-term collaborations for software development, maintenance, and support services.
5. Innovation and R&D:
India's IT industry is not just about cost arbitrage; it is also a hub for innovation, research, and development. Many global technology firms have set up innovation centers, research labs, and technology incubators in India to tap into the country's talent pool and drive innovation. These centers focus on developing next-generation technologies, conducting R&D activities, and creating intellectual property in areas such as artificial intelligence, machine learning, blockchain, and cloud computing.
2. Telecommunications:
India's telecommunications sector has witnessed significant FDI inflows, driven by the rapid expansion of mobile and internet services. With a massive consumer base and increasing smartphone penetration, telecom companies are investing heavily in network infrastructure, spectrum auctions, and digital technologies to capitalize on the growing demand for data services.
India's telecommunications sector has emerged as a prominent recipient of Foreign Direct Investment (FDI) due to several key factors:
1. Expanding Market Potential:
India has one of the largest telecommunications markets in the world, with over a billion mobile subscribers and rapidly increasing internet penetration. The country's vast population, growing middle class, and rising disposable incomes have fueled the demand for voice, data, and digital services across urban and rural areas. This immense market potential offers lucrative opportunities for telecom companies to invest in network infrastructure, spectrum allocation, and innovative services to cater to the diverse needs of consumers.
2. Mobile Revolution:
India has witnessed a mobile revolution in recent years, driven by affordable smartphones, competitive tariffs, and widespread adoption of mobile internet services. The proliferation of mobile devices has transformed communication, commerce, and entertainment, creating new business models and revenue streams for telecom operators. Foreign investors recognize India's mobile-first market dynamics and are keen to capitalize on the growing demand for voice calls, messaging apps, mobile data, and value-added services.
3. Digital Connectivity:
The government's Digital India initiative aims to bridge the digital divide and promote inclusive growth by ensuring broadband connectivity to all citizens. This ambitious program has spurred investments in fiber-optic networks, 4G/5G infrastructure, and rural broadband initiatives to enhance digital connectivity and enable access to digital services in remote areas. Foreign telecom companies view India's digital transformation as an opportunity to deploy advanced technologies, improve network coverage, and deliver high-speed internet services to underserved communities.
4. Spectrum Auctions:
Spectrum is a critical asset for telecom operators to expand their network capacity, improve service quality, and offer new services to customers. India's spectrum auctions provide an opportunity for telecom companies to acquire additional spectrum bands and strengthen their market position. Foreign investors participate in these auctions to acquire spectrum licenses and invest in network upgrades, spectrum refarming, and technology modernization to enhance their competitiveness in the market.
5. Convergence of Services:
The convergence of telecommunications with other sectors such as media, entertainment, and technology is driving investment opportunities in integrated services and content delivery platforms. Foreign telecom operators are exploring partnerships, mergers, and acquisitions with content providers, OTT (Over-the-Top) platforms, and digital media companies to offer bundled services, streaming content, and personalized experiences to subscribers.
6. Policy Reforms:
The Indian government has introduced several policy reforms to liberalize the telecom sector, attract foreign investment, and promote healthy competition. Initiatives such as National Digital Communications Policy (NDCP), ease of doing business reforms, and regulatory clarity have created a favorable investment climate for telecom companies. Foreign investors are encouraged by the government's commitment to reforming regulations, promoting innovation, and fostering a vibrant telecom ecosystem in India.

Career Opportunities in Telecommunications for ECE Students
The world we live in is more interconnected than ever before & at the center of it all is telecommunication. From phone & internet to satellites & 5G, telecommunications play a key role in how we communicate, work & live. For Electronics & Communication Engineering (ECE) students, this presents exciting & secure career options.
As an ECE student, you already have the foundation needed to be employed in this sector. You know electronics, signal processing & communications systems, which all work well together in telecom. So if you’re wondering about telecommunications careers for ECE students, you’re already heading in the right direction as this industry is booming & needs competent professionals at all times.
With that being said, here are some excellent career opportunities in telecommunications for ECE students:
Network Planning & Optimization Engineer
One of the most sought-after job opportunities after ECE in telecom is that of a Network Planning Engineer. These professionals plan & optimize telecom networks to ensure users receive good & stable signals. Whether it’s for mobile data, calls or broadband — network engineers make it all possible.
During their college years, ECE students learn how signals propagate & devices interact, which makes them ideal for this job. Additionally, you get to become proficient at working with various frequency bands, tower locations & coverage optimization. So if you like technical planning & coming up with practical solutions, this might be the career for you.
RF (Radio Frequency) Engineer
Another in-demand telecom job is that of an RF Engineer. RF Engineers deal with the wireless aspect of communications such as antennas, transmitters & receivers. They ensure data is transmitted effectively via radio waves, which is essential for mobile networks, Wi-Fi & even satellites.
This is one of the best telecom roles for electronics graduates who enjoy working with hardware & field equipment. Plus, you get to work on exciting technologies & contribute to building faster & better networks. Also, with the rise of 4G & 5G networks, RF engineers are in huge demand.
Telecom Software Engineer
Although telecom is usually regarded as a hardware discipline, there is also significant demand for software engineers in telecom firms. These individuals develop the software that runs on telecom devices, manages networks or facilitates services such as VoIP & mobile applications.
ECE students with programming skills or who have pursued courses in languages such as Python, Java or C++ can consider this career. This is a very suitable job for those who like coding & communication technologies..

Tata Elxsi Q1 FY26 Results: Profit Drops 22% YoY to ₹144 Crore Amid Global Weakness
Introduction
Tata Elxsi, a leading design and technology services provider, reported its Q1 FY26 results, showing a noticeable decline in both revenue and profit. A 22% year-on-year drop in net profit and a 3.7% decline in revenue have raised concerns among investors and analysts alike.
While short-term pressures are evident, the company continues to emphasize its long-term strategic focus and future growth potential.
Q1 FY26 Financial Summary
Key MetricQ1 FY26Q1 FY25ChangeNet Profit₹144 crore₹184 crore-22.0%Revenue₹892 crore₹926 crore-3.7%Earnings Per Share (EPS)DeclinedStableNegative impactOperating MarginsPressuredStrongLoweredCash FlowPositivePositiveMaintained
What Caused the Decline?
Macroeconomic Headwinds
Tata Elxsi faced challenges due to global inflation, slower client decision-making, and delayed project execution, especially in international markets.
Lower Tech Spending Globally
Client industries such as automotive, consumer electronics, and embedded systems saw reduced IT spending, which directly impacted Tata Elxsi’s top-line performance.
Rising Costs
Operational costs rose due to talent retention, salary revisions, and return-to-office-related expenses, contributing to margin compression.
Management Commentary
Managing Director and CEO Manoj Raghavan acknowledged the weaker performance but reaffirmed confidence in the company’s long-term outlook:
"While this quarter has been challenging, our strategic wins and strong order pipeline give us confidence in our growth trajectory for the remainder of the year."
The company plans to deepen investments in AI, design-led engineering, digital platforms, and talent development to sustain momentum.
Positive Development: Large US Deal Secured
Tata Elxsi signed a multi-million-dollar deal with a US-based technology company during the quarter. This contract is expected to positively influence revenue from Q2 onwards and enhances visibility for the second half of FY26.
Stock Market Reaction
Post-result, Tata Elxsi shares saw an intraday decline of 4–5%. Market sentiment remains mixed:
Some brokerages have revised short-term targets downward
Others view the current correction as a potential long-term buying opportunity
How Tata Elxsi Compares to Peers
The results reflect broader trends across Indian IT, where companies like Infosys, TCS, and Wipro have also reported cautious earnings due to global softness.
However, Tata Elxsi’s profit decline was steeper, while its revenue performance aligned with industry averages.
Understanding Tata Elxsi’s Business Model
Unlike traditional IT firms, Tata Elxsi operates in specialized areas:
Automotive software (including EV and autonomous systems)
Digital healthcare platforms
Media and OTT technology
Artificial Intelligence and IoT
Its client base includes top global companies in automotive, healthcare, and telecom—sectors that are both evolving and volatile.
Future Growth Opportunities
Electric Vehicles and Autonomous Technology
As the global automotive industry shifts toward EVs and autonomy, Tata Elxsi’s automotive expertise positions it strongly for future opportunities.
Growth in AI, ML, and Digital Engineering
Rising enterprise demand for AI-driven and human-centered design services supports long-term prospects for Tata Elxsi’s core offerings.
Outlook for FY26
Near-Term
Q2 may remain under pressure, but ramp-up from the newly signed deal is expected to begin. Operational efficiency and margin control will be critical.
Long-Term
With a healthy order book, continued focus on R&D, and expanding global partnerships, Tata Elxsi is optimistic about delivering a stronger performance in the second half of FY26.
